What does it mean to be an accredited Labour Broker?

While labour brokers provide an important service to the industry, compliance to the relevant legislation and bargaining councils is paramount. The Constructional Engineering Association TES Division was established by labour brokers as a self-regulatory body that also enabled them to keep abreast of the latest legislative developments, as well as assuring clients of the highest standards of good governance and legal compliance to industry requirements. The TESD is the only body of labour brokers in the sector that has introduced an accreditation process. Click here to view the TESD website
